I love music. I learned to play the guitar at 11 and I wrote my first song four years later. My dream -----to become a country singer.
After years of hard work, a record company was showing interest in me. One day during a trip to mountains, a friend gave me a bit of meth, a kind of drugs(毒品). I smoked it. And that was all that I thought about for the next year and a half. I couldn’t live without it.
When the police came to me, I looked like death. The first seven days in prison(监狱), I just slept. When I woke up on the eighth day, I had never known such shame and guilt(罪恶感). I walked down the hall to the pay phone. My mama is the best person on the earth, and I knew this was going to break her heart. When I heard her voice on the phone, I told her where I was. She just said, “Son, no matter what you did, I love you forever(永远).
Her words gave me the confidence to face my trouble(麻烦). And I also realized(意识到) this was my chance to start a new life.
When people hear my words, I hope they will not make the same mistake(错误) as I have, but I know that you can overcome(克服) almost anything, especially smoking drug. That’s why I share my story here.

Body language is the quiet, secret and most powerful language of all! It is said that our body movements communicate about 50 percent of what we really mean while words only express 7 percent. So, while your mouth is closed, your body is just saying..
Arms. How you hold your arms shows how open and receptive(能容纳的) you are to people you meet. If you keep your arms to the sides of your body or behind your back, this suggests you are not afraid of anything. Outgoing people generally use their arms with big movements, while quieter people keep them close to their bodies. If someone upsets you, just cross your arms to show you"re unhappy!
Head.When you want to appear confident, keep your head level(水平). However, to be friendly in listening or speaking, you must move your head a little.
Legs. Your legs will move around a lot more than usual when you are nervous or telling lies.
Posture(姿势). A good posture makes you feel better about yourself. If you are feeling unhappy, you usually don"t sit straight, with your shoulders inwards. This makes breathing more difficult and makes you feel nervous or uncomfortable.
    Face.When you lie, you might put on a false face. But that expression would not last long.  And your true emotions such as happiness, sadness, fear and so on will come through.
